Laws § 259.183","heading":"Conduct constituting felony; penalty.","body":"Sec. 183.\n\nA person who willfully and without authority takes possession of or uses an aircraft, or unlawfully removes or takes any component parts of an aircraft, and a person who assists in, or is a party to taking illegal possession of or use of an aircraft or component parts belonging to another, and a person who willfully and unlawfully makes an aircraft unsafe, and a person who assists in, or is a party to making an aircraft unsafe, is guilty of a felony punishable by imprisonment for not more than 5 years, a fine of not more than $2,000.00, or community service of not more than 6 months, or any combination of these penalties.","path":["MI Code","Chapter 259","Act Act-327-of-1945"],"source_url":"https://www.legislature.mi.gov/Laws/MCL?objectName=mcl-259-183","current_through":"2026-08-14","vintage":"open-us-law v2026.08, retrieved 2026-09-14","retrieved_at":"2026-09-14T18:32:31Z","sha256":"b631cda75c44b2ce50f8c437bbd24880db12fb55706027c97c280d611cbee9f5","source_id":"us-mi","stale":false,"prev":"us-mi/mich.-comp.-laws-259.182","next":"us-mi/mich.-comp.-laws-259.184"},"notice":"GroundRules: Original legal text.
